Somebody can tell me how to convert wordstar files to word from french or italian. (problem of accents).
Title: Re: Converter for foreign files
Post by: PGAGA on January 26, 2008, 11:18:49 PM
Saturday, January 26, 2008

If you are using WS7d, then use Star Exchange to convert the files to RTF.

Your other option is to download and try the converters listed here:

http://www.wordstar.org/wordstar/pages/convert_faq.htm

Habit will convert extended characters into text or HTML, which word can read.
